This weekend the WSJ wrote an article on some of my efforts to communicate to the public about energy and climate change, and LinkedIn’s censorship, then reversal of that censorship decision.  I am pleased that the WSJ wrote a piece about my education efforts as it draws attention to these critical issues.

Unfortunately, they titled the article “Energy CEO Fights Climate Science…”  Quite the opposite, my goal is to make big-picture learnings from climate science more accessible to the public and put them in context with the appropriate tradeoffs regarding energy affordability, reliability, and security.

Presumably, the “fights climate science” comes from the fact that an IPCC author said I should be censored for stating false conclusions.  Except my comments stating that hurricanes, tornadoes, droughts, or floods were not increasing in frequency or magnitude was correct.  The data backing that up is referenced in the Bettering Human Lives report released in August last year.  In the WSJ article, the authority quoted to rebut me only spoke about one, ONE of the claims I made: drought.  The IPCC does say that soil moisture deficits are increasing, a factor impacted by human activities like farming.  The IPCC does NOT say that meteorological or hydrological droughts are increasing.  I have no desire to censor the quoted IPCC author, but he has his facts wrong in this case.

Professor Roger Pielke Jr., perhaps the world’s foremost scholar on extreme weather trends, has written extensively on this topic.  Here is one of his pieces on the IPCC’s work on extreme weather:

https://rogerpielkejr.substack.com/p/how-to-understand-the-new-ipcc-report-1e3

Here is another on the 2022 year in review:

https://rogerpielkejr.substack.com/p/dont-believe-the-hype

Below are several links covering many more issues:  What the Media Won’t Tell You About . . .

Engage with Pielke Jr.’s writings if you want to garner a deeper understanding of extreme weather data and the gross mishandling of this issue, unfortunately, illustrated in this WSJ piece.

Disappointing that the journal would find someone unable to get it right on droughts — one tiny topic in my broad 12-minute video — to justify a headline that I “fight(s) climate science.”

My goal is to short-circuit the media, activists, and politicians who thrive on frightening, alarmist climate pronouncements that are often at odds with the facts.  In Liberty’s Bettering Human Lives report, I wrote a 12-page long section on climate change and climate economics along with an extensive list of references for the dialogue.  Far from “fighting it,” I want to spread a basic understanding of climate change so that we can engage in a more sober conversation around the unavoidable tradeoffs that must be made on climate goals, our energy system, and poverty abatement.

“Liberty Oilfield challenges climate change assumptions as it trolls The North Face”

by Greg Avery

 

Chris Wright has never been shy about challenging conventional wisdom, and nowhere is that more obvious than in his Denver-based fracking company’s corporate sustainability report.

Half of the 84-page sustainability report issued in early June by Liberty Oilfield Services, the second-largest U.S. provider of hydraulic fracturing and related well services, lays out detailed challenges to widespread assumptions about climate change and energy policy beliefs.

“We’ve always been honest followers of the data in our business. Why would we be any different here?” Wright said.

Rather than scare off shareholders, many investors will appreciate Liberty making its case, he predicts.

Liberty’s sustainability report covers how natural gas replacing coal has been a major driver in U.S. greenhouse gas emissions reduction and how some of the effects of climate change often cited in calls for immediate public policy action — such as a quickening rise in sea levels and increasingly severe and deadly weather events — aren’t supported by factual data.

Liberty’s sustainability report published the same week that Wright and Liberty Oilfield released a new video and downtown billboard praising The North Face, an outdoor clothing brand of Denver-based VF Corp., for using petroleum products to make “puffer” jackets and other items.

Wright appeared on Fox Business cable news and did other media interviews about the video, billboard and accompanying public relations campaign.

It’s a continuation of the Denver oil and gas industry’s effort to highlight The North Face’s reliance on petroleum products after it rejected selling 400 co-branded jackets to a Houston-based fracking company. The North Face said it was making its co-branding sales align with the company’s commitments to sustainability and environmental protection.

The oil and gas industry considers that hypocritical, given the degree to which North Face products and the outdoor pursuits of its customers rely on fossil fuels. Calling it out is meant to attract attention to oil and gas uses that are being left out of the public narrative about sustainability, Wright said.

“It’s just trying to bring a sober, thoughtful dialogue to this issue,” he said. “We have a very unhealthy climate for talking about energy, and we want to change that.”

Half of Liberty Oilfield’s sustainability report still is devoted to the company’s environmental protection strategies.

That includes 25% of its fracking fleets — the large pumper trucks that push fracking fluid and sand under incredible pressure down the well bore — running new diesel engines that reduce particulate emissions by 87% compared to traditional fleets.

The engines are Tier IV “dynamic gas blend” diesel engines. They’ll become the standard engine in future new fleets the company puts into the field, Liberty says.

It has also been developing and expects to soon start using fracking fleets powered by electricity, what Liberty calls its digiFrac fleet.

Other companies have started using electric fracking, but those systems are dependent on electricity generated by a natural gas turbine power plant the fracking project sets up nearby. The overall emissions of the system aren’t necessarily better than the clean-burning Tier IV diesel fracking fleets, Wright says, while Liberty’s digiFrac fleet will have at least 20% fewer emissions than the clean diesel fleets, Wright said.

A digiFrac system is being tested in fracking projects in West Texas now, the company says. Liberty expects commercially roll out its first commercial digiFrac fleet next year.
